Transaction 414c51dd6410541040fbaef498a5c377a3591de460f0515facb529be86b6db04

1 Input
2 Outputs
  • 414c51dd6410541040fbaef498a5c377a3591de460f0515facb529be86b6db04:0
  • value  43884677
    address  15zhJszEqBLLPSTQQNRzDR1geCjhP2utsw
  • 414c51dd6410541040fbaef498a5c377a3591de460f0515facb529be86b6db04:1
  • value  2470000
    address  1KQcKEFPPDvm8NWoSuEdZmTPf88728gYJJ